
IT8212 、またはより正確にはIT8212Fは、ITE Tech が設計したローエンドのパラレル ATAコントローラです。実装されているBIOSと構成に応じて、IT8212F はRAID モードまたはATAPIモードで機能し、デュアル チャネルを使用して最大 4 つのデバイスをサポートします。 RAID モードは IDE ハード ディスク ドライブのみをサポートし、RAID 0、RAID 1、RAID 0+1、JBODに加えて、基本的に標準のハード ディスク コントローラとして機能する「通常」モードが含まれます。 CD-ROMやDVDドライブなどの光ディスク ドライブはATAPI モードでサポートされ、RAID 機能はすべて使用できなくなりますが、ハード ディスク ドライブもサポートされます。 RAID 機能は組み込みのマイクロプロセッサによって実装されるため、いわゆる「ソフト RAID」コントローラではありません。
ITEのIT8212Fをベースにしたデバイスは、アドオンカードとパソコンのマザーボードに組み込むコンポーネントの2つの異なる形態に分類されます。ITEはこれらの最終製品を製造しておらず、コントローラまたは製造権、そしてリファレンスデザインをサードパーティに販売し、最終製品への使用を許可しています。異なる実装には大きな非互換性があり、BIOSのアップデートやドライバコードの機能セットの変換が必要となり、ユーザーに不便を強いています。
コントローラのBIOSは通常、専用のオンボードフラッシュメモリデバイスに保存されます。ただし、コントローラがマザーボードに統合されている場合は、コントローラのBIOSとマザーボードのBIOSが1つに統合されることがよくあります。BIOSのアップグレードは、非常に困難な場合があります。一部のコントローラには、変更できないワンタイムプログラマブルメモリチップが搭載されています。また、ITEのBIOSフラッシュユーティリティでサポートされていないデバイスを使用するものもありますが、Uniflashユーティリティを使用した場合の成功例も報告されています。BIOSはRAIDとATAPIの両方の機能を同時に設定することはできないため、メーカーの判断により、ユーザーがこれらのモードを切り替えることができない場合があります。
IT8212F は、ITE の暫定仕様 V0.3 に従って、ATAPI-6 仕様に準拠しており、転送モード PIO モード 0、1、2、3、4、DMA モード 0、1、2、および UDMA モード 0、1、2、3、4、5、6 をサポートしています。また、PCI 2.2 仕様もサポートしています。
2005 年現在、IT8212 は、この CompUSA PATA RAID カードなどのローエンド RAID カードで使用されています。
IT8212F IDEコントローラ製品ページ